The Singularity can cause whole populations to ascend.Įxpect examples of this trope to make use of the words "ascend" and "above" in line with Heaven Above, where the divine and supernatural are associated with the sky above us. If the character has left their clothes behind, untouched, it's a case of Shapeshifting Excludes Clothing. Sometimes the accession isn't even meant to be permanent if the writer needs some way for a character to enter a higher plane, then leave with something important like knowledge or a new power. If the writers should need the character back, it can be very easy to reverse, in which case the character will De-power as a God in Human Form. A way to put the character on a bus, though that's not all that it's used for. It is mostly a way to pay off a character. It can result from other supernatural causes, but is most often used as a character's fate after they die, in a riff on the idea of a heavenly afterlife. The character ascends to a higher state of being, possibly even becoming a god.
